What You’ll Need to Make Witch Cookies

*Ingredient amounts are located in the recipe card at the end of this post.

Fudge Stripe Cookies: The most popular brand of store-bought Fudge Striped Cookies are Keebler brand, but many stores have a generic brand as well. Either option will work as the base of the hat. You can also use OREO cookies, especially fudge covered OREOS, or another type of chocolate cookie.

Hershey’s Kisses: Unwrap 28 Hershey’s milk chocolate Kisses. These will act as the top of the hat and can be found on the candy aisle at your grocery store.

Frosting: If desired, you can pipe purple, green, or orange icing to give this fun Halloween cookie a witchy look.

How To Make Halloween Witch Cookies

[Step 1] Flip all of the fudge striped cookies over and place cookies stripe-side down on parchment paper, wax paper, or a baking sheet.

Fudge stripe cookies on parchment paper.
Step 1

[Step 2] Warm a pan over medium heat. Once the pan is warm, touch the bottom of the Hershey Kiss to the pan long enough for the chocolate to melt.

Melting the bottom of a Hershey kiss in a hot pan.
Step 2

[Step 3] Immediately place the Kiss, melted chocolate side down, on the center of each cookie over the hole in the middle. Repeat with the rest of the cookies.

A Hershey kiss added to a fudge stripe cookie to make witch's hats.
Step 3

[Step 4] If desired, pipe a line around the Hershey Kiss on the witch hats to add more detail to the cookies. That’s it!

How to Store Witch Cookies

If you’re making these adorable Witch Hat Cookies ahead of time, store them in an airtight container in a cool place. You can also freeze the cookies for up to 1 month.

Tips and Variations

  • If desired, you can use other flavors/varieties of Hershey Kisses such as mint or almond!
  • For a special touch, you can melt white chocolate and dip the bottom of each cookie into it before sticking on the Hershey’s Kiss.
  • You can also roll each cookie in festive sprinkles!
  • For a spooky look, use black frosting instead of purple or green.
  • If desired, use homemade frosting instead of store bought. Just make sure it holds its shape when piped.

Halloween Witch Cookies

Yield: 28 Cookies
Prep Time: 15 minutes

Get into the Halloween spirit with these adorably spooky Witch Hat cookies! Made with store-bought fudge striped cookies and topped with a Hershey's Kiss, this easy Halloween treat is both delicious and fun to make.

Ingredients

  • 28 Fudge Striped Cookies
  • 28 Hershey's Kisses, unwrapped
  • Purple or Green Frosting, if desired.

Instructions

  1. Flip all of the fudge striped cookies over and place cookies stripe-side down on parchment paper, wax paper, or a baking sheet.
  2. Warm a pan over medium heat. Once the pan is warm, touch the bottom of the Hershey Kiss to the pan long enough for the chocolate to melt.
  3. Immediately place the Kiss, melted chocolate side down, on the center of each cookie over the hole in the middle. Repeat with the rest of the cookies.
  4. If desired, pipe a line around the Hershey Kiss on the witch hats to add more detail to the cookies. That's it!
